Question,GroundTruth
How do I get into college?, "College is an institution of higher level education where students can pursue advanced academic and professional knowledge, skills, and personal development of their choice beyond high school. To apply, you typically need to submit an application form, transcripts, standardized test scores (if required), letters of recommendation, and a personal statement or essay, all according to the specific requirements and deadlines of each institution."

What is computer science?, "Computer science is the study of computational systems and algorithms, encompassing both theoretical principles and practical applications to design, analyze, and improve software and hardware systems."
I would like some scholarships for low income students, "A rather famous example is the Gates Scholarship, which would cover full tuition if you’re one of the lucky ones who gains it! Other examples are: the Quest-bridge National College Match, the Dell Scholars, and the Hagan Scholarship."
